Responsibilities

  • Lead the development, optimization, and validation of advanced material manufacturing processes from concept through commercialization.
  • Partner with manufacturing teams and suppliers to improve process capability, scalability, and production readiness.
  • Analyze material performance data, laboratory testing results, and manufacturing metrics to identify improvement opportunities.
  • Develop and implement process controls, operating windows, validation plans, and engineering standards.
  • Apply statistical methods including Statistical Process Control (SPC), Design of Experiments (DOE), and process capability analysis to reduce variation and improve quality.
  • Lead root cause investigations related to material performance, process variation, and manufacturing challenges.
  • Translate technical findings into Design for Manufacturing (DFM) guidelines and scalable production requirements.
  • Support factory trials, process validation activities, and commercialization efforts with global manufacturing partners.
  • Create technical documentation including process specifications, control plans, and manufacturing best practices.
  • Collaborate across Materials, Product Creation, Quality, Supply Chain, and Manufacturing teams to drive technical decisions.

Requirements

  • Bachelor’s degree in Polymer Engineering, Materials Science, Chemical Engineering, Mechanical Engineering, or a related technical discipline.
  • 3+ years of experience in materials development, polymer engineering, process engineering, or manufacturing engineering.
  • Experience working with polymer materials and material characterization.
  • Experience developing, testing, optimizing, or scaling materials and manufacturing processes.
  • Strong analytical skills with experience interpreting technical data and using data-driven approaches to solve problems.
  • Experience with process improvement methodologies such as SPC, DOE, process capability analysis, or similar techniques.
  • Ability to work effectively in manufacturing environments and collaborate with factory or supplier partners.
  • Strong communication skills with the ability to influence cross-functional teams.
  • Self-starter who can independently manage projects, prioritize work, and drive results.

Preferred Qualifications

  • Experience with polyurethane (PU) materials, elastomers, foams, coatings, adhesives, or similar polymer systems.
  • Laboratory testing experience related to material performance, reliability, or validation.
  • Experience supporting product commercialization, manufacturing scale-up, or new product introduction (NPI).
  • Experience with Design for Manufacturing (DFM) principles.
  • Experience working with global manufacturing partners or suppliers.
  • Familiarity with statistical analysis software.
  • Experience in apparel, footwear, sporting goods, consumer products, or other materials-driven industries.
  • CNC, tooling, or manufacturing process certifications.
